Dyepkazah ShibayanNasir Yusuf Gawuna, governorship candidate of the All Progressives Congress in Kano, has congratulated Abba Kabir Yusuf, his opponent, and governor-elect of the state.

Though the APC had asked the electoral commission to review the election, the governor-elect received his certificate of return from INEC on Wednesday. “I am congratulating him and I pray for him for Allah’s guidance in his administration,” the APC candidate said.

Kano APC Gov Candidate Accepts Defeat, Urges Supporters To Recognise NNPP’s Yusuf As Governor-Elect | Sahara ReportersThe governorship candidate of the All Progressives Congress (APC) in Kano state, Nasir Yusuf Gawuna, has accepted defeat in the March 18, 2023, governorship election. He also congratulated the governor-elect, Abba Kabir Yusuf of the New Nigeria People’s Party (NNPP). The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) earlier declared Yusuf as the governor-elect after he polled a total of 1,019,602 votes to defeat Gawuna, his closest contender, who polled 890,705 votes.
